2003 LANCER 2.OLT=REPLACED BATTERY,REPLACED 100AMP FUZE@BATT=CAR TURNS OVER BUT WON'T START! A JUMP START WAS ATTEMPTED BUT BELIEVE THEY CROSSED THE CABLES! HELP !

[email protected] all the fuses and relays in the 2 boxes under the hood and another one of fuses and relays panel inside the car, front of the driver seat, behind the pull out box next to the hood release handle..Under the hood check inside the one with 8" black square box;Check # 1 slot fuse, it is 60 amps for (+B ), check # 8 slot fuse for Engine control 20 amps, check # 15 slot Fuel pump 15 amps..And check another skinny black box lie next to that box, it has relay F, that is Engine control, check that also...And inside the car fuses panel; Check # 1 slot fuse 10 amps that for Ignition coil, # 8 slot Engine control 7.5 amps, # 12 slot Engine control 7.5 amps..After that recheck the battery post, that maybe needed re-tight..Don't force to tight too much, that will crack and broke the post and the plastic battery body...And check all the ignition wires and spark plugs that are tight or needed to replace..And check all the vacuum lines that are loose and leaks suctions or sometimes they are crack open by long ages..By the way check and recheck all those other fuses and relay for make sure they are good...Believe me that not hard to figure out those problems..You did everything rights so far..That one 100 amps fuse at the + battery post cable was connect to alternator for recharging your battery and give power to other items when car was running..Below that post, the middle cable was connect to the starter motor and the bottom cable was connect to that 8" black fuses and relays box under the hood...

My 2003 lancer over heated and won't start now.

too late, but the answer is: when the water system loses enough water, there is a sensor in the water inlet that tells the computer that there is no water, then the computer will not allow the engine to start, I check it on a radiator change I had to make a lancer 2006, we wanted to move the car a few meters but did not start because the hoses were not installed and the block had no water, so we had to start pouring water with a garden hose to the water inlet of the block and in that way started the engine.
